Back in 2004 Halle Berry set up the based-on-a-true-story Brockovichian drama TULIA but the project never got off the ground. About three years later Lionsgate has come aboard to breathe new life into the film. The film would star Berry as an Indian born woman, Vanita Gupta, who works as the attorney for the NAACP looking to overturn the convictions of 46 black men arrested in a drug bust that turned up no drugs, money or weapons. The script, written by Karen Croner, is based on the book “Tulia: Race, Cocaine, and Corruption in a Small Texas Town.” Lionsgate is currently in negotiations with Carl Franklin (OUT OF TIME) to direct. Berry has both the thriller PERFECT STRANGER and the Benecio Del Toro drama THINGS WE LOST IN THE FIRE due later this year. Filming on TULIA would begin May 1st in Lousiana.
